FREE SCREENING :PACQUIAO VS MARGARITO!

Olongapo City Convention Center (OCCC) has always been a place for the exciting fights of 7-division boxing champion Manny Pacquiao and on November 14, 2010, starting at 9:00 o’clock in the morning, Olongapenos will once again have the opportunity to watch the much awaited bout between Manny Pacquiao and Antonio Margarito in the said venue.

It has become a tradition for Olongapo Mayor James ‘Bong’ Gordon Jr. to arrange for the free screening of the fight of Manny Pacquiao at OCCC.

Pacquiao will be facing Margarito for the first time after he pummeled Joshua Clottey in March 2010.

LCD televisions and projectors will be installed at the OCCC for the screening of the fight.

“Maganda na pumila na ng maaga ang mga gustong manood para hindi sila mawalan ng upuan. Dahil sa dami ng mga manonood, limited lang ang capacity na makakapasok para makanood ng laban kaya first-come first-served ang mangyayari,” Mayor Gordon said.

“Nais ni Mayor Gordon na saksihan ng mga Olongapeno first hand ang laban na ito bilang pagsuporta na rin sa pambato ng Pilipinas,” Dentist Donald Vigo, who is also the coordinator for the event said.

It can be recalled that more than four thousand (4,000) Olongapenos were able to watch Pacman’s previous victorious fight against the Ghanaian Clottey also through the free screening at the OCCC. This is one of the many sports projects of Mayor Gordon as part of his HELPS program.

Should Pacquiao beat Margarito, he will become the 1st boxer to win 8 world titles in 8 divisions.Margarito, a former world welterweight champion, was suspended last year by the California State Athletic Commission after he was caught with a plaster-like substance in his hand wraps prior to his bout against Shane Mosley on January 2009.

If Margarito fails to get a license in Nevada, the fight will be held in Monterrey, Mexico. Pacquiao has said that he is very much willing to face Margarito, despite the Mexican champ’s height advantage.
